Industry Switching Strategies with S&P 500 ETFs

Sector rotation is a dynamic investment tactic where investors shift their allocations among different sectors of the stock market based on prevailing economic conditions and performance trends. Portfolio managers employing this strategy aim to profit on cyclical movements within the S&P Best 3x leveraged technology ETFs 500, a benchmark index tracking the performance of 500 large-cap U.S. companies.

By utilizing ETFs (Exchange-Traded Funds) that track specific sectors, investors can effectively execute sector rotation strategies. For example, during periods of economic prosperity, investors may allocate to ETFs focusing on cyclical sectors such as technology. Conversely, in a stagnant economy, healthcare sectors might attract to investors seeking more resilient assets.

  • Careful monitoring of economic indicators and market trends is crucial for identifying potential sector rotation opportunities.
  • Asset Allocation across multiple sectors can help mitigate overall portfolio risk.
  • Historical performance is not indicative of future results, and investors should conduct in-depth research before implementing any investment strategy.
